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items differs between air carriers, the general rule to follow is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like tools, metal cutlery, fuel and fireworks. Sports equipment like bows and arrows, and items that could harm other people, such as firearms and swords, can’t come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The best way to ensure a comfortable flight can be as simple as your clothing choices. Prepare for changes in temperature by bringing layers. That way you’ll stay nice and warm if the cabin begins to cool down. Shoes like high heels and sandals are best left in your checked suitcase. Instead, opt for flat, closed-toed footwear like slip-ons. Your feet will appreciate it.
  • Unfortunately, one risk of long-distance flying is developing de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ged inactivity. To prevent this, take every opportunity to walk around the cabin and stretch your legs. Compression tights and socks are another simple way to help lower your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Red Lodge?
It’s all about being organized. We’ve rounded up some top tips for a speedy trip through airport security. Look out Red Lodge, here you come:

  • Keep your travel documents and ID at hand. They’ll be the first things you’ll be asked to show at security.
  • After that, both you and your carry-on luggage will be X-rayed. To speed things up, remove anything that is likely to set the alarm off. Items such as your jacket, belt and earphones need to go through the machine.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ronics must also go through the scanner.
  • Don’t for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each product should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a practical footwear choice as you’re less likely to be required to remove them when passing through security. Big bo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to additional screening.
  • Pocket knives and other sharp items are prohibited in the cabin. They’ll be seized at security, so pack them safely away in your checked suitcase.
